RAILROAD CROSSING WARNING SYSTEM FOR ENHANCED ROUTE PLANNING
20230050879 · 2023-02-16 ·

In an embodiment, a system for detection of trains at railroad crossings is provided. The system comprises a field-deployed detection and reporting device comprising a microphone, a communication module, a microprocessor, and an application. When executed on the microprocessor, the application receives data describing sounds captured by the microphone and identifies frequencies of a first received sound. The application also transmits, based on the identified frequencies and a formula, a first message via the communication module. The first received sound is generated by a warning bell sounded at the railroad crossing. The first message is received by a backend server that issues a first broadcast based on receipt of the first message. The application further determines that the first received sound discontinues. Based on the determination, the application sends a second message via the module to the backend server which issues a second broadcast that the crossing is reopened.

S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R DETERMINING PASSAGE STATUS OF A TRAIN AT A RAILROAD CROSSING

This disclosure is generally directed to systems and methods for determining a passage status of a train through a railroad crossing. In an example method, a railroad crossing status detector system provided in a vehicle may determine that a train is approaching the railroad crossing. The determination is made by evaluating a first detection signal received from a first train detection apparatus located on one side of the railroad crossing. The railroad crossing status detector system may then evaluate a second detection signal received from a second train detection apparatus located on the other side of the railroad crossing and determine that the train has traveled past the railroad crossing. The system may also evaluate one or both detection signals to determine whether the train is currently located at the railroad crossing or is backing up after traveling at least partway across the railroad crossing.

MOBILE SENSOR-BASED RAILWAY CROSSING SAFETY DEVICE
20230347952 · 2023-11-02 ·

A device for detecting an approaching train at a roadway railway crossing and providing an intervention for avoiding a collision that avoids the need for crossing site approval, installations, etc. and associated hardware and installation costs. The device may be configured as a stand-alone device, as an accessory matable to a motor vehicle (e.g., via an OBD II port), or may be fully integrated into the motor vehicle. The device includes a microphone for receiving an ambient audio signal, and processes the audio signal to determine whether a train is present. If so, the device may provide an audible and/or visual warning signal to a vehicle driver, via the device itself or via components of the motor vehicle. In certain other embodiments, the device is configured to provide a control signal causing operation of braking, engine, steering or other vehicle systems to avoid a collision.

Vehicle advisory system

A vehicle advisory system and method determine whether a vehicle system moving along a route is within a designated distance of a feature of interest, initiate a distance-based alert sequence of an advisory device of the vehicle system in response to determining that the vehicle system is at or within the designated distance of the feature of interest, and generate advisory signals using the advisory device according to the distance-based alert sequence. The advisory signals are indicative of passage of the vehicle system by the feature of interest during the distance-based alert sequence. The distance-based alert sequence dictates one or more of plural different commencement locations or commencement distances at which advisory signals are generated by the advisory device. The distance-based alert sequence also dictates one or more of plural different termination locations or termination distances where generation of the advisory signals by the advisory device is terminated.

System to provide real-time railroad grade crossing information to support traffic management decision-making

A system that automatically communicates the event or potential event of a blocked railroad grade crossing to various users, including but not limited to emergency dispatchers and drivers, news media, traffic management systems, and the general public, specifically the location, time, and duration of the event or potential event. The system applies multiple technologies to detect the presence of activity on a rail line, transmits this detection data to a database, performs various analyses on the data, and communicates the status of grade crossings (blocked, potentially blocked, upcoming blockage, or clear) to assist various users with information to make more informed decisions.

Railroad crossing gate monitoring and alarm system
10589766 · 2020-03-17 · ·

Aspects of the disclosed embodiments generally relate to a current monitoring and alarm system for a railroad crossing gate. The system is capable of determining that the gate is functioning properly or not. In addition, the system can issue an alarm or provide some other indicator when the gate is not functioning properly or is being subjected to excessive loading.

Circuit arrangement for revealing light signal errors
09656681 · 2017-05-23 · ·

A circuit arrangement for revealing light signal errors, in particular for railway safety systems, includes an electronic signal generator, which can be disconnected in a reversible manner in the event of an error, and a control part, configured for incandescent lamps, for controlling and monitoring the signal generator. The device for revealing errors includes an error differentiator between the line-related interference voltage and error of the signal generator. The reliability of the error differentiation is improved and rendered independent of capacitive intermediate energy storage devices, in that the signal generator is connected to a resistance arrangement such that the signal generator voltage is greater, in high-resistance signal generators, than an interference voltage.
